Output 70ae33ba79e15cde7bea53caba6127967b73daa714853f9533dbf70a29cabb92:0

value
6984742935944
script pubkey
OP_0 OP_PUSHBYTES_20 7d869d582f5184c059fc4466a015b838107819d0
address
tb1q0krf6kp02xzvqk0ug3n2q9dc8qg8sxwsnk9a4p
transaction
70ae33ba79e15cde7bea53caba6127967b73daa714853f9533dbf70a29cabb92
confirmations
173148
spent
true